The Interior Design Needs Assessment form is an essential tool for interior design professionals seeking to understand their clients' preferences and expectations. This form facilitates the collection of valuable insights that can guide designers in tailoring their services to meet specific project requirements. By capturing detailed information about clients' needs, styles, and functional desires, this form not only streamlines the design process but also enhances client satisfaction. Ultimately, it serves as a foundational step in creating spaces that resonate with clients' visions, fostering a collaborative and informed design journey.


This form plays a critical role in the project lifecycle by ensuring that designers have a clear understanding of client expectations before the design phase begins. Frequently asked questions
Why is a interior design needs assessment used?
chevron down icon
An interior design needs assessment is used to gather detailed information about a client's preferences, challenges, and expectations, ensuring that the design process is tailored to their specific needs.
What should be included in a interior design needs assessment?
chevron down icon
An interior design needs assessment should include fields for the industry, years of experience in interior design, areas of expertise, the importance of functionality in design, current challenges, future expectations for the space, and market position.
When to use a interior design needs assessment?
chevron down icon
An interior design needs assessment should be used at the beginning of a project to collect comprehensive information from clients, allowing designers to create personalized and effective design solutions.
